Celtic are back in action on Thursday night, when they face Ferencvaros in the Europa League. The Bhoys kick off their league phase with a home clash, and it's a much-needed home clash after the weekend's drubbing at Rangers.

The Hoops have struggling in tough away atmospheres, and that points to the need for Martin O'Neill's men to take full advantage of their home clashes in this league phase. Picking up wins at home will be the difference between Celtic progressing or not in this campaign.

Ahead of the Europa League opener, we have put together the predicted Celtic starting lineup.

GK - Viljami Sinisalo

O'Neill needs to put his weight behind Sinisalo. He made a mistake by starting Sam Johnstone in the derby, and he needs to put it right.

LB - Kieran Tierney

Tierney will surely start on the left, even with the demand of playing twice in a week. Celtic need to start this campaign well, and they will need to ask Tierney to pick up the load.

CB - Auston Trusty

Trusty should come back in here. He was done a fine job this season and needs to start these big games.

CB - Cameron Carter-Vickers

There could be a question mark here. Carter-Vickers looked as though he was struggling a little over the weekend having shaken off an injury recently. This could be a big ask if he is still feeling the effects of that setback, but if he is fully fit, the American international starts.

RB - Colby Donovan

The only player who really showed some fight over the weekend, Donovan should be rewarded with a start.

CDM - Callum McGregor

Celtic don't have many options in the holding midfield role, so McGregor, even at his age, will likely have to keep soldiering on with little rest.

CDM - Mika Baur

Again, Celtic don't have many options due to Alex Oxlade-Chamberlain remaining suspensed. Baur needs to get back to his best after a disappointing Old Firm.

CAM - Benjamin Nygren

Nygren is the obvious starter in the attacking midfield role.

LW - Camilo Duran

Tounekti is not likely to start, so then it becomes about what O'Neill does on the left. Duran could well play out there for this one.

RW - Haissem Hassan

Back to full fitness, Hassan, who was the only threat in the Old Firm, should be getting the start.

CF - Kasper Hogh

Hogh should probably be dropped after a disappointing run of form, and if this was a suggested XI, either Duran plays here or Shim Mheuka gets a chance, but it's a predicted XI, and O'Neill hasn't liked to drop big-name players.
